Abstract

Systems and methods of Ethernet link state signaling through a packet fabric with an Ethernet service transported over Optical Transport Network (OTN) utilizing Generic Framing Procedure Framed (GFP-F) mapping include demapping packets received from an OTN container over GFP-F; detecting a condition associated with the Ethernet service; and causing insertion of maintenance signals in OTN overhead based on the condition instead of using GFP-F Client Management Frames (CMF). The GFP-F mapping can be compliant to ITU-T Recommendation G.Sup43 (02/11) clause 6.2.
